Workers installed overhead equipment (OHE) and wires for Mumbai Metro-9 near Kashigaon station in Mira Road (East) on Monday. The project, undertaken by the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A), is an extension of the existing Mumbai Metro Line-7 (Red Line) between Andheri and Dahisar to Mira Road (PICS/SATEJ SHINDE)

Metro-9 will be the first-ever metro line in Thane district. PIC/SATEJ SHINDE

On May 14, Maharashtra CM Devendra Fadnavis had flagged off the trial run and technical inspection of Phase-1 of Metro Line-9

The line connects Mira-Bhayandar to Mumbai’s western and eastern suburbs as well as the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j International Airport (CSMIA)

Once fully operational, the metro line will provide direct commute to Mumbai Airport via Metro Lines 7 and 7A, Andheri (West) via Line 2B, Ghatkopar via Lines 7 and 1, Link Road via Line-2A at Dahisar (East), Thane via Line-10 (future development), Vasai-Virar via the upcoming Line-13

Phase-1 spans 4.4 km, running from Dahisar (East) to Kashigaon, with stations at Dahisar (East), Pandurangwadi, Miragaon, and Kashigaon

It is a part of India’s first double-decker metro and flyover project, sharing a single viaduct structure
